What we are looking for:
Were looking for an IT Infrastructure Officer to support the availability performance and security of Councils IT infrastructure with a particular emphasis on implementing administering and optimising CCTV networks AV equipment meetingroom technology and mediaproduction environments.
Youll work closely with the IT Infrastructure Coordinator project teams and external vendors to ensure our new buildings communication and media capabilities are reliable secure and ready for future growth.
What your day will look like:
- Implement administer and maintain Councils Windows-based IT environments including systems CCTV cameras NVRs storage monitoring platforms and network connectivity.
- Assist with infrastructure asset lifecycle management including investigation procurement configuration testing installation and maintenance of CCTV/AV hardware and related network components.
- Support cybersecurity activities through patching policy compliance awareness initiatives and operational security practices.
- Contribute to disaster recovery and business continuity readiness through documentation testing and improvement of recovery processes.
- Deliver IT infrastructure projects by preparing business cases coordinating tasks conducting testing and providing stakeholder support.
